The Pentegra Defined Contribution Plan for financial institutions
The Pentegra Defined Contribution Plan for Financial Institutions provides plan sponsors with all of the services needed to run a successful 401(k) program—plan design and document support, administrative and actuarial services, investment management and trustee services and ongoing consulting and education—and the added value of our unique fiduciary role.
As a multiple employer program, participating financial institutions enjoy valuable economies of scale. With over $4 billion in assets under management, we are able to leverage the buying power of hundreds of organizations to offer our clients numerous economies of scale, producing tangible benefits for customers in the form of lower retirement program costs and investment management fees. Only a single plan audit, 5500 filing and plan document are required, resulting in considerable cost savings for members.
Our client list of more than 500 financial institutions includes the Independent Community Bankers of America (ICBA), the Federal Home Loan Bank System and America's Community Bankers (ACB).
OUR UNIQUE FIDUCIARY ROLE
The Pentegra Defined Contribution Plan for Financial Institutions offers a distinct advantage—the opportunity to completely outsource primary fiduciary responsibility for the management of your retirement program—something no other provider that we know of offers.
Pentegra serves as the ERISA-Named Plan Administrator and principal fiduciary for the program. Our President and Board of Directors—comprised of our clients—assume these responsibilities for our clients, prudently monitoring and documenting all decisions affecting your plan and its investments. As the fiduciary for the Plan, our Board of Directors must approve our fee structure and investment policy. As a Pentegra client, you’ll benefit from the due diligence that we perform to ensure that your plan operates in the best interests of your participants.
